Since the invention of computers, their capabilities have grown exponentially. Human beings have developed the power of computer systems in terms of their diverse working domains, increasing speed, and reducing size over time.

 The artificial intelligence Foundation is a branch of computer science dedicated to creating computers or machines as intelligent as human beings.

What is Artificial Intelligence?

John McCarthy, the father of Artificial Intelligence, defined it as “The science and engineering of making intelligent machines, especially intelligent computer programs”.

Artificial intelligence is a branch of computer science that endeavors to create computers, robots, or software that can think intelligently.

 Artificial intelligence can be achieved by studying the way humans think and learning, decide, and work while trying to solve a problem. These findings can then be used as a basis for developing intelligent software and systems.

Goals of AI

The goals of the foundation of ai are – 

To create expert systems, one must create a knowledge-based system that can learn, demonstrate and explain its actions, and advise its users.

Implementing the capabilities of human intelligence in machines may enable systems that understand, think, learn, and behave like humans.

Programming Without and With AI

Programming Without AI

  1.  A computer program without artificial intelligence can only solve specific questions.
  2.  Modification to a program’s code can change its structure.
  3.  Modifications can adversely affect a program.

Programming With AI

  1.  A computer program with AI can respond to generic types of questions it is meant to answer.
  2. Artificial intelligence (AI) programs are capable of absorbing new modifications by putting together highly independent pieces of information. Hence, you can modify even a minute piece of information in the program without having to rework the code.
  3.  The program is easy to customize.

What is AI Technique?

In the real world, the knowledge that is available has some unwelcome properties—its volume is enormous, next to unimaginable; it is not well-organized or well-formatted; it changes constantly.

 AI techniques are methods to organize and use knowledge in such a way that − It should be perceivable by the people providing it. It should be easily modifiable to correct errors. It should be useful in many situations though it is incomplete or inaccurate. AI techniques elevate the speed of execution of complex programs they are equipped with.

Applications of AI

 AI has been successful in a variety of fields, such as −

  1. Gaming
  2. Natural Language Processing
  3. Expert Systems 
  4. Vision Systems
  5. Speech Recognition
  6. Handwriting Recognition
  7. Intelligent Robots

Career Opportunities in Artificial Intelligence Foundation

